On background-independent renormalization of spin foam models

Bahr, Benjamin

Understand

In this article we discuss an implementation of renormalization group ideas to spin foam models, where there is no a priori length scale with which to define the flow.

  • In the context of the continuum limit of these models, we show how the notion of cylindrical consistency of path integral measures gives a natural analogue of Wilson's RG flow equations for background-independent systems.
  • We discuss the conditions for the continuum measures to be diffeomorphism-invariant, and consider both exact and approximate examples.
